不使用class和id进行网页布局的方法是通过CSS选择器和HTML标签属性来实现网页布局的一种方式。以下是具体的攻略过程:
- 使用HTML标签属性进行区分
在HTML中每个标签都有若干个属性,比如a标签有href属性用于指定链接地址,img标签有src属性用于指定图片资源。因此可以使用这些标签本身所具有的属性来进行区分和样式的设置。例如,通过以下的代码来实现两列布局:
<div>
<p style="float:left; width:50%">左边的内容</p>
<p style="float:right; width:50%">右边的内容</p>
</div>
在上述代码中,通过给左右两个p标签添加style属性和对应的CSS样式,来实现左右两列的布局,同时也避免了使用class和id。
- 使用CSS选择器进行区分
CSS中提供了多种选择器,可以根据标签名、属性以及标签的结构关系等来选择相应的元素。因此,可以利用这些选择器来实现元素的区分和样式的设置。下面通过一个示例来说明:
<ul>
<li>列表项1</li>
<li>列表项2</li>
<li>列表项3</li>
</ul>
上述是一个简单的无序列表,要对其中的每个列表项进行样式的设置,可以使用以下的CSS选择器:
ul li {
padding: 10px;
border: 1px solid #ccc;
}
在上述代码中,使用了CSS选择器ul li来选择每个列表项,并对这些选择的元素应用了样式。
总结:以上是通过HTML标签属性和CSS选择器来实现网页布局的方法,这些方法没有使用class和id,可以使网页代码更为简洁易懂,同时也提高了代码的复用性。
本站文章如无特殊说明,均为本站原创,如若转载,请注明出处:不使用class和id进行网页布局的方法 - Python技术站